Output 5166ffe23756630430bdc2414c6bb5143a06c7389c7e01d7bb42aa592fe96d04:1

value
18538907
script pubkey
OP_0 OP_PUSHBYTES_20 c59b69c6960d712c81a0c802a1bd4ff9fc29cfc3
address
bc1qckdkn35kp4cjeqdqeqp2r020l87znn7rmwaqwa
transaction
5166ffe23756630430bdc2414c6bb5143a06c7389c7e01d7bb42aa592fe96d04